After years stuck in streaming jail, one of TV’s best cop dramas ever is free at last — and back on the beat. All seven seasons of Homicide: Life on the Street are finally available to stream on Peacock, as of today, so fans who didn’t catch its original 1993-99 run on NBC can now […]